Abstract

The invention discloses a kind of efficient bactericidal composite containing Hexanaphthene flusulfamide, the bactericidal composition containing active components A Yu active component B, active components A is selected from Hexanaphthene flusulfamide, and active component B is selected from following any one compound:Triazolone, antibiotic in pyrimidine nucleoside class, 2-cyano-3-amino-3-phenylancryic acetate, bromothalonil, and active components A and the weight ratio of active component B are 1: 60~80: 1.The present composition has greater activity to the multiple diseases in various crop, and with obvious synergistic effect, expands fungicidal spectrum.And with dosage is small, resistance of rainwater washing against, the characteristics of synergy is obvious.

Technical background
Hexanaphthene flusulfamide chemical name:N- (2- trifluoromethyl-4-chlorophenyls)-a- oxocyclohexyls Sulfonamide.It has stronger prevention, treatment and osmotically active, and has lasting effect higher. It is bright through table of field test results, Hexanaphthene flusulfamide can effectively prevent and treat gray mold, sclerotinia rot of colza, Cucumber Target Leaf Spot and scab.
In the real process of agricultural production, controlling disease is easiest to generate the problem that disease resists The generation of the property of medicine.Different cultivars composition is compounded, and is to prevent and treat the very common method of resistance disease. Heterogeneity is compounded, and judges that certain compounding is synergy, adds according to practical application effect With still antagonism.In most cases, the compounding effect of agricultural chemicals is all additive effect, The real compounding for having synergistic effect seldom, especially synergistic effect clearly, synergy ratio very Compounding high is just less.Studied by inventor, find by Hexanaphthene flusulfamide and triazolone, Antibiotic in pyrimidine nucleoside class, 2-cyano-3-amino-3-phenylancryic acetate, bromothalonil are mutually compounded, and are had within the specific limits very Good synergistic effect, and about Hexanaphthene flusulfamide and triazolone, antibiotic in pyrimidine nucleoside class, cyanogen The related compounding of alkene bacterium ester, bromothalonil, at present at home and abroad there is not yet relevant report.

The embodiment of the present invention is the method being combined using Toxicity Determination and field test.First By Toxicity Determination, clear and definite two kinds of medicaments compound by a certain percentage after synergy ratio (SR), SR < 0.5 are antagonism, and 0.5≤SR≤1.5 are summation action, SR > 1.5 It is synergistic effect, on this basis, then carries out field test.
Test method:After determining the effective inhibition concentration scope of each medicament through prerun, medicament is by effective Component content sets 5 dosage treatment respectively, if clear water is compareed.Reference《Agricultural chemicals indoor biological is surveyed Determine test rule bactericide》Carry out, medicament is determined to crop germ using mycelial growth rate method Virulence.With crossing method measurement colony diameter after 72h, each treatment net growth of calculating, Mycelial growth inhibition rate.
Net growth (mm)=measurement colony diameter -5
Mycelial growth inhibition rate is converted into probit value (y), liquor strength (μ g/mL) conversion Into logarithm value (x), virulence regression equation (y=a+bx) is tried to achieve with least square method, and thus Calculate the EC of every kind of medicament50Value.Two medicament different ratios are calculated according to Wadley methods simultaneously Synergy ratio (SR), SR < 0.5 are antagonism, and 0.5≤SR≤1.5 are made to be added With SR > 1.5 are synergistic effect.Computing formula is as follows:
Wherein:A, b are respectively active components A and the shared ratios in combination of active component B;
A is Hexanaphthene flusulfamide;
B is selected from one of triazolone, antibiotic in pyrimidine nucleoside class, 2-cyano-3-amino-3-phenylancryic acetate, bromothalonil and plants.
